Worm's Head Cliffs
Worm's Head is a tidal promontory at the western end of Rhossili Bay on Wales's Gower Peninsula. Its cliffs are formed mainly from Carboniferous Limestone, and the headland is linked to the mainland by a causeway that can be crossed only during a limited period around low tide. The site is used for walking, coastal viewing, and wildlife observation.
